Offered is a professional model R3631 Pete Rose Mizuno bat dating to his 1981 season with the Philadelphia Phillies when he set the National League record for career hits by passing Stan Musial's career total of 3,630. Bat currently measures 34.5" & weighs 33 ounces with a black marker signature & pair of inscriptions ("1981 Became National League All Time Hit Leader 3631" & "Good Luck") from Rose on the sanded portion of the barrel. PSA/DNA hologram/LOA 1B16823 will also attend. MEARS A5. (35K0040)
